WebIncident Light Measurement – Reflected Light Measurement. A big advantage of your external exposure meter is the incident light measurement which prevents object-related incorrect exposures. In contrast to the reflected light measurement of the camera-internal exposure meters which measure the light reflected by the object, the external exposure … WebLight Meter PCE-170 A to 40,000 lux, internal sensor, automatic zero adjustment. Web3 uur geleden · NEW BRITAIN, PA — Local parents Tim and Julia Yoder were understandably upset when their 17-year-old daughter Carlie came home drunk last … fredy wolfingerWebHold your meter in front of your subject. And check to see where the light is coming from. First, you need to find the light then carefully place your meter in front of your subject, not to the camera. Now press the metering button to measure the light in the scene. Set the reading in your camera’s exposure setting. bliss birth port kemblaWebBatteries Included.
